Helicopter crash in the Gulf of Mexico kills 3 oil rig workers

Various news sources are reporting that a helicopter crash in the Gulf of Mexico has killed 3 oil rig workers on their way to an unmanned oil platform in the Gulf of Mexico.

What law applies to a helicopter crash over a navigable body of water like the Gulf of Mexico?

This analysis is extremely complicated.  Only a very experienced maritime attorney will be able to steer you through the proper legal analysis.  

In some situations, the case could be filed under the Jones Act.  In other cases involving wrongful death, the case may have to be filed unde the Death on the High Seas Act.  In still others, the case may be a Longshore & Harbor Workers Compensation Act case.
